The packaging is absolutely stunning! What these are really are the latest line of lipsticks following this years trend for balm like lipsticks and these are as lovely as any other I've tried.
I find some of the colours don't work well for me as I my lips are too pigmented to carry off sheer pale colours but regardless these lipsticks feel lovely on, are moisturising and are fab for every day wear.
In comparison to the other lipsticks in this style I've tried, the Clinique Chubby Sticks, Chanel's Coco Shine's (which I've only tried in store) and the Shiseido Shimmering Rouge's, I personally find them all very similar in consistency and wear. But what I will say for these Lancome ones is that the packaging is by far the prettiest!

So there we have it. Well worth a look if this style of lipstick is your thing, they feel beautiful on, add a light sheen but absoltuely zero stickyness and are £19.50.
My fave is 103, seemingly a nothing in the swatch, but a gorgeous sheer berry shade on the lips.
